Edexcel GCSE Maths, Foundation Teacher Companion provides thorough lesson plans and schemes of work to help deliver exam success in Edexcel's new Maths GCSE. The teacher companion supports the corresponding student book provides you with all the support you need get the best out of your students. Powered by MyMaths the series links directly to the ever popular web site offering students a further source of appropriate support.
